The model of level broadening in condensed phase
M V Basilevsky1, G V Davidovich, A I Voronin
1Photochemistry Center, Russian Academy of Science, ul. Novatorov 7a, Moscow 117421, Russia. basil@photonics.ru
This study introduces a new method for solving quantum relaxation equations, revealing an energy-dependent extended Lorentzian distribution for harmonic oscillator populations. This non-Markovian model offers insights into quantum systems.
Area of Science:
- Quantum kinetics
- Statistical mechanics
- Physical chemistry
Background:
- Non-Markovian dynamics are crucial for understanding open quantum systems.
- Quantum relaxation equations describe the evolution of system populations.
- Previous work introduced a square root Fourier distribution for non-Markovian systems.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op a new approximate method for solving quantum relaxation equations.
- To determine the distribution of level populations for a harmonic oscillator in a heat bath.
- To compare the new distribution with existing non-Markovian models.
Main Methods:
- Modeling a harmonic oscillator coupled to a harmonic heat bath.
- Developing a novel scheme for approximate solution of the quantum relaxation equation.
- Analyzing the resulting distribution of level populations.
Main Results:
- An extended Lorentzian distribution for level populations was found, with energy-dependent width.
- This distribution exhibits exponential decay away from its center.
- The new distribution closely relates to the square root Fourier distribution and reproduces Lorentzian widths.
Conclusions:
- The proposed method provides an accurate approximation for non-Markovian quantum kinetics.
- The extended Lorentzian distribution offers a useful model for quantum system relaxation.
- The findings connect to established approximations like the Redfield approximation.
